Foundation Of The National Student Nurses Association

Organization Overview

Foundation Of The National Student Nurses Association is located in Brooklyn, NY. The organization was established in 1970. According to its NTEE Classification (E12) the organization is classified as: Fund Raising & Fund Distribution, under the broad grouping of Health Care and related organizations. This organization is an independent organization and not affiliated with a larger national or regional group of organizations. Foundation Of The National Student Nurses Association is a 501(c)(3) and as such, is described as a "Charitable or Religous organization or a private foundation" by the IRS.

For the year ending 05/2023, Foundation Of The National Student Nurses Association generated $621.8k in total revenue. This represents relatively stable growth, over the past 4 years the organization has increased revenue by an average of 4.8% each year. All expenses for the organization totaled $1.2m during the year ending 05/2023. While expenses have increased by 10.6% per year over the past 4 years. They've been increasing with an increasing level of total revenue. You can explore the organizations financials more deeply in the financial statements section below.

Since 2020, Foundation Of The National Student Nurses Association has awarded 18 individual grants totaling $223,871. If you would like to learn more about the grant giving history of this organization, scroll down to the grant profile section of this page.

Describe the Organization's Mission:

Part 3 - Line 1

TO SUPPORT NURSING EDUCATION AND PROMOTE THE NURSING PROFESSION

Describe the Organization's Program Activity:

Part 3 - Line 4a

DURING FISCAL 2023 FNSNA PROVIDED GRANTS TO 228 RECIPIENTS. FNSNA PROVIDES FUNDING OPPORTUNITIES TO A DIVERSE STUDENT POPULATION, INCLUDING STUDENTS FROM UNDERREPRESENTED POPULATIONS WITHIN THE NURSING PROFESSION. GRANTS PROVIDED BY THE FNSNA SUPPORT THE EDUCATIONAL ENDEAVORS OF NURSING STUDENTS ACROSS THE COUNTRY TO PRODUCE OUTSTANDING REGISTERED NURSES. FUNDING FOR NURSING EDUCATION AND SPECIAL PROJECTS ALLOWS NURSING STUDENTS TO FOCUS THEIR ATTENTION ON GAINING CRITICAL LEADERSHIP EXPERIENCE TO ULTIMATELY PROVIDE HIGH QUALITY PATIENT CARE AND TO EXCEL IN ALL AREAS OF NURSING. FNSNA FUNDING PRIORITIES PROVIDE THE MEANS FOR NURSING STUDENTS TO DISCOVER THEIR TALENTS AND CREATE A VISION FOR THEIR CAREERS, ACHIEVING A SENSE OF CONFIDENCE AND SELF-WORTH. THIS ENDEAVOR ENABLES NURSING STUDENTS TO COMPLETE THEIR EDUCATION AND ENTER THE WORKFORCE AS EXCEPTIONAL REGISTERED NURSES WHO PROMOTE QUALITY HEALTHCARE FOR ALL.
